perlunity.de - PERL | JAVASCRIPT | PHP | MySQL | APACHE



#!/COMMUNITY

Members: 5374
davon online: 1
weitere User: 15
Click for quality!




12.02.2012 / 02:56

Community-Member werden   |   Paßwort vergessen   |   OnlineMonitor (1) Wer ist online ... OnlineMonitor starten !
     

 

Home


PERLscripts


PHPscripts


JAVAscripts


Hilfreiches


Links2www


Newscenter


Community


Interna




Community  »  PERLunity: Rund um die Community zur Themenübersicht Themensuche Themenansicht in Thread-Modus


BeitragKaufmännisches Runden
Seitenanfang
Hallo,

falls es mal jemand braucht :


#-----------------------------------------
# sub fgdRunden ( Zahl, Nachkommastellen )
# -> kaufmaennisches Runden
#-----------------------------------------
sub fgdRunden {

my $dInput = shift ( @_ ) || 0;
my $iStelle = shift ( @_ ) || 0;


my $iVorz = ( $dInput < 0 ) ? -1 : 1;

my $dErg = int ( $dInput * (10**$iStelle) + ( $iVorz*0.5 ) ) / ( 10**$iStelle);

return ( $dErg );

} # end sub fgdRFunden

Datum: 11.04.2006-09:39

Beitragre: Kaufmännisches Runden
Seitenanfang
Hi,

sehr guter Beitrag. ;-)

Und hier der Grund, warum man sich nicht auf das System verlassen sollte, wenn man finanziell augerichtete Applikationen entwickelt.

http://perldoc.perl.org/perlfaq4.html#Does-Perl-have-a-round%28%29-function%3F--What-about-ceil%28%29-and-floor%28%29%3F--Trig-functions%3F

-uw

Datum: 11.04.2006-13:47

-






-
-